| Temperature control system has been applied in lots of domains in social lives,which fits for the industries such as household electric appliance industry,food service industry,automobile,material,electric power and electron.etc.Simultaneously,the embedded system as the significant element to realize device and instrument which is miniaturization,intelligent and self-knowledge innovation has been played more and more indispensable role in the field of national defense,aviations,traffic,industry,communication and social lives.Uniting embedded and the temperature control system,a applied embedded water temperature control system is designed in this paper.The system composing and its software and hardware design method are explained.The high speed of collection and respond,low power consumption are the system characteristics.The main contents of this paper are as follows:1.The history,status and development trend of temperature control system and the research content are discussed.2.Introducing briefly the embedded system and its basis knowledge in design and development,the SAMSUNG company's S3C44B0X with ARM7TDMI kernel,the configuration and kernel frame of the real time operating systemμC/OS-Ⅱsystem.3.In the hardware aspects,this paper establish the design project of key board system and the extend circuit.The key board system includes system module,memory module and the human-computer interaction module.The extend circuit includes temperature detection circuit and power control circuit.4.In the software aspects,this paper compile the start-up codes of ARM7,replantation codes ofμC/OS-Ⅱto S3C44B0X,application programs of embedded temperature control system and its relative charts. 5.Results after the temperature control system successful running and what.
